Offensive Line

Arguably the worst performing area on the team in 2018.  The depth was destroyed with injuries early and often last season.  It all started with center A.Q. Shipley in camp last August.

He tore an ACL in the Red-White practice.  Now he will be coming back off of that but also fighting for a job with Mason Cole.  He will have pressure on him to make this squad.

It just starts there though.  The line lost D.J. Humphries, Justin Pugh, and had a poor showing from free agent Andre Smith.  They gave up on him before the season ended.

They went out and got a stud offensive line coach in Sean Kugler.  Pugh returns but Humphries has question marks on when he will be ready.  He did not get placed on the PUP list though.

They signed J.R. Sweezy and Max Garcia as free agents.  Sweezy comes over from the Seattle Seahawks and Garcia from the Denver Broncos.  Garcia did get placed on the PUP list though coming off a 2018 injury.

They also signed free agent Desmond Harrison from the Cleveland Browns after his release.  However that was a short lived relationship after he was arrested for a domestic issue.  He was subsequently released by the Cardinals.
